Changchun - The University of Camerino welcomed an official delegation from Jilin Agricultural University on 17 November to celebrate two decades of academic cooperation, one of the institution’s longest-standing international partnerships. The event followed the visit of Unicam’s Rector, Graziano Leoni, to Changchun last September for the Chinese anniversary ceremonies.
Over the years, the collaboration launched in 2005 has evolved into a genuine academic and cultural alliance, built on faculty and student exchanges, joint research projects and, most notably, the creation of a shared degree programme in biotechnology. This initiative, now a dual-degree course taught entirely in English and active in both Italy and China, has involved hundreds of students and stands as one of Unicam’s most accomplished internationalisation models.
“We are celebrating twenty years of mutual trust and shared work, a collaboration that has grown into a real cultural and scientific partnership,” Leoni said. He stressed that the relationship with Jilin has become a platform capable of responding to global challenges such as sustainability, health, emerging technologies and the protection of natural resources.
“Universities are cultural bridges and laboratories of innovation,” he added. “Dialogue generates peace, growth, and the possibility of building stronger communities able to look ahead.”
